President Yameen Ratifies Protection of Reputation and Freedom of Expression Bill

11 August 2016, Male',
President Abdulla Yameen Abdul Gayoom has today ratified the ‘Protection of Reputation and Freedom of Expression’ bill, which was passed by the Parliament on 9th August 2016.
Protection of Reputation and Freedom of Expression Act aims at preventing malicious defamation and protecting the reputation of individuals. The Maldives Constitution of 2008 sets out an expanded Bill of Rights, including freedom of expression (article 27) and a right to reputation and good name (article 33), and freedom of media (article 28). At the same time, the Constitution also recognises in Article 16, on the need to regulate, by a legislation of the Parliament, on how the rights can be exercised.
